  8. Nockturnal nocks dont require you to glue anything and the switch to activate it is more reliable than a Luminock IMO. They weigh only 20 grains or so, so they are lighter too.

  19. I'm using the Trophy Taker Ulmer Edge. Kinda like a Shwacker/Rage combo. It opens up with the same concept as the Shwacker but is rear deploying like a rage. Had results like your entry and exit holes there. I have always read good things about Shwacker. below is a pic of the Ulmer Edge.. See what I mean on the similarity?
